Dr. Lewis provides a wide variety of seminars and training programs ranging from 1 hour to two days in duration. He makes every effort to tailor the presentation to meet the specific needs of the organization or audience. In addition to workshops and seminars, Dr. Lewis provides on-going consultation when an organization is attempting to facilitate a system-wide transition or modification that could impact the human asset (employees). Also, he provides consultation around policies, procedures, plans and protocols designed to improve organizational resiliency.
